    Hart P.

    Just finished a relaxing brunch with the family at Postino's 12 South. Also, just found out this is a chain. Since it is the only one in Nashville, much less TN, it's a stand alone to me and quite good. Twelve South has a very active eating culture with many favorites. Parking is challenging but the walks aren't too aweful. Postino's brunch is much better than the well known one down the street. The atmosphere is open and relaxed, not crammed. The outdoor seating looks great but not on the chilly day we were here. Reservations are recommended on the weekend and we had them but they wouldn't have been necessary before noon. We were seated by our server upon our arrival. The wine list covers a wide range of flavors but isn't very deep. The full bar can conjure anything. Kyle came back serveral times to get multiple orders. Menu items are closer to tapas to be enjoyed while drinking, so Postino's might not be your number 1 dining location but great for a gather place or pre-dinner cocktail. We popped around the menu trying different things. For us, the bruschetta is reminiscent of smorrebrod, Danish open-faced sandwiches. Those are a hit with us. Everything felt house made with carefully thought out flavors. Tops was the salmon pesto bruschetta and the vanilla glaze dipping sauce for the donut bites. By the way, excellent preparation of the eggs. With its central location, this is a great place for us to gather and talk.

    Ask the Community - Postino 12 South

    Do you have gluten free choices?

    Hi Patricia if you browse our menu through our Allergens + Nutritionals portal you'll be able to see which items are gluten free: https://www.postinowinecafe.com/allergens-and-nutrition Thank you!

    Do you have an event space for 40 for a rehearsal dinner pizza salad and wine and can I get a quote?Saerahurley656@gmail?

    Hi Sara! Please reach out to our catering and group dining team here, we'd be happy to talk more about your upcoming event: https://www.postinowinecafe.com/catered-events/group-dining

    Where do you park?

    There is a parking lot across 12th street from where our restaurant is situated.
